EBV (EA) IGG, SERUM
Detects Epstein-Barr Virus (EBV) early antigen IgG antibodies, indicating past or ongoing infection with EBV. It is useful for diagnosing infectious mononucleosis.

This test detects IgG antibodies against EBV viral capsid antigen (VCA), indicating past infection with the Epstein-Barr virus.
It helps determine whether someone has been previously infected with EBV, which causes infectious mononucleosis and is linked to some cancers.
A blood sample is tested using immunoassays like ELISA to detect EBV VCA-specific IgG antibodies.
A positive IgG result typically indicates past infection and long-term immunity. Negative results suggest no prior exposure.
